LAVERDA

Festuca rubra rubra

Strong creeping red fescue

Dense & fine leaved with improved visual merit in summer

Excellent visual merit

The overall visual merit is high, and with an improvement during the summer months that makes LAVERDA a perfect choice for ornamental mixtures for parks and homelawns.

The colour of leaves is medium green.

Tolerance to several diseases

The visual aspect is defended by good tolerance to common diseases like Microdochium patch, fusarium blight, leaf spot and red thread disease.

Wear and tear tolerance

LAVERDA shows improved tolerance to wear, allowing to include it for use in lawns exposed to traffic, play & game. 

The abundant production of rhizomes helps recolonising bare spots and is enhancing the persistency.
